Key Features of Simultaneous Heat Pump Units
Simultaneous heat pump units utilise R290, a natural refrigerant with a Global Warming Potential (GWP) of just 3 and zero Ozone Depletion Potential (ODP), ensuring an environmentally sustainable cooling and heating solution. Designed for ultra-low noise operation, these units deliver up to 70°C in heating mode and -7°C in cooling mode, making them highly versatile across various applications. They do not require ATEX compliance, simplifying installation and regulatory approvals.
The system can contribute up to four BREEAM points, enhancing a building’s sustainability rating. With up to a 50% lower carbon footprint, based on annual refrigerant leakage assessments in line with TM65, these units provide a significant reduction in emissions. Their compact footprint allows for easy integration, making them a space-efficient and high-performance solution for both new and retrofit projects.
